#18c8c8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#18c8c8 is composed of 9.4% red, 78.4%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88% cyan, 0%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 180 degrees, a saturation of 78.6% and a lightness of 43.9%. #18c8c8 color hex could be obtained by blending #30ffff with #009191. Closest websafe color is: #00cccc.

Shades and Tints of #18c8c8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010707 is the darkest color, while #f5fef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#18c8c8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e7272 is the less saturated color, while #07d9d9 is the most saturated one.
